离子迁移管中湿度变化对毒品和烟酰胺检测的影响  被引量:1

Influence of humidity change in ion transport tube on detection of drugs and nicotinamide

摘  要:通过改变离子管内部的载气湿度,来监测冰毒、氯胺酮和可卡因等3种毒品以及烟酰胺的探测灵敏度和迁移率。实验结果显示,离子管内气体湿度从1%到30%变化时,烟酰胺、冰毒、氯胺酮和可卡因4种样品的特征峰强度分别下降了61%,37%,39%和64%;而它们的迁移时间分别增加了0.75,0.55,0.325和0.225 ms。4种样品的灵敏度随着湿度的增加有不同程度的下降,样品的迁移时间随湿度的变化存在一定规律性,即迁移时间小(迁移率大)的样品其受湿度影响更为显著。上述规律性的存在也使得现有数据库对样品迁移时间偏移值的定义需要做出修正。The humidity in the ion tube greatly affects the sensitivity and the mobility of sample.By changing the tube humidity,the detection sensitivity and mobility coefficient of four samples of methamphetamine,ketamine,cocaine and nicotinamide were monitored.The experimental results showed that the peak intensities of nicotinamide,methamphetamine,ketamine and cocaine respectively decreased 61%,37%,39%and 64%when the gas humidity in the ion tube changed from 1%to 30%,while the drift time respectively increased0.75,0.55,0.325 and 0.225 ms.This indicated that the drift time of the four samples has a certain regularity with the humidity changes.The sample owns shorter drift time the influence of humility inside tube on it is more significantly.This regularity indicates the necessary to modify the definition of the offset of drift time.
